„Wenn ein Arbeiter seine Arbeit gut machen will, muss er zuerst seine Werkzeuge schärfen.“ – Konfuzius, „Die Gespräche des Konfuzius. Lu Linggong“
Titelseite > Programmierung > Was sind die besten Möglichkeiten, eine Ganzzahl in eine Zeichenfolge in Java umzuwandeln?

Was sind die besten Möglichkeiten, eine Ganzzahl in eine Zeichenfolge in Java umzuwandeln?

Gepostet am 2025-03-23
Durchsuche:857

What are the Best Ways to Convert an Integer to a String in Java?

Java -Konvertierung von int zu string

In Java können in Java auf verschiedene Arten konvertiert werden. Eine gemeinsame Methode ist die Verwendung des Operators, wie aus dem bereitgestellten Code -Snippet zu sehen ist:

int i = 5;
String strI = ""   i;

Es ist jedoch wichtig zu beachten, dass dieser Ansatz in Java nicht die Norm ist. Stattdessen sind die bevorzugten Methoden zum Konvertieren eines int in eine Zeichenfolge:

  • Integer.toString (int): Gibt die String -Darstellung des angegebenen Integer -Werts zurück. Der Wert von Ganzzahl im Standard -Dezimalformat. Sie sind effizient und prägnant und machen sie zu den empfohlenen Optionen für Int-to-String-Konvertierungen.
  • Obwohl die Verkettungsmethode funktioniert, wird sie als unkonventionelle Praxis angesehen und kann auf ein Mangel an Wissen über die geeigneteren Methoden hinweisen. Darüber hinaus beinhaltet es einen gewissen Overhead in Bezug auf Effizienz im Vergleich zu Integer.toString () oder String.ValueOf ().
Javas Unterstützung für den Bediener mit Strings erlaubt es, die Verkettung auf eine bestimmte Art und Weise zu bewältigen:

. StringBuilder:

stringBuilder sb = new StringBuilder (); Sb.Append (""); sb.append (i); String stri = sb.toString ();
  • , während diese Übersetzung sicherstellt, dass die Code korrekt funktioniert, ist es etwas weniger effizient als die dedizierten Methoden zur Int-to-to-String-Konvertierung zu verwenden. String.ValueOf () Methoden zum Konvertieren von INTs in Java für Klarheit, Konvention und Effizienz.
Neuestes Tutorial Mehr>

Haftungsausschluss: Alle bereitgestellten Ressourcen stammen teilweise aus dem Internet. Wenn eine Verletzung Ihres Urheberrechts oder anderer Rechte und Interessen vorliegt, erläutern Sie bitte die detaillierten Gründe und legen Sie einen Nachweis des Urheberrechts oder Ihrer Rechte und Interessen vor und senden Sie ihn dann an die E-Mail-Adresse: [email protected] Wir werden die Angelegenheit so schnell wie möglich für Sie erledigen.

Copyright© 2022 湘ICP备2022001581号-3